The Hockey East preseason coach's poll for women's hockey was released on Tuesday. The Eagles are ranked fourth this fall, behind Providence, New Hampshire and Maine. The conference is in its second year.
The Eagles were 12-17-3 overall last season, 2-10-3 in Hockey East. Boston College named Tom Mutch the head coach for the women's team over the summer, and he is expected to produce an outstanding program for the 2003-04 season.
Alaina Clark (Alhambra, CA) and Jill McInnis (Quincy, MA), the team's top performers, will both be returning to the ice. Clark led the team with 21 points last season, from 12 goals ands nine assists. McInnis led BC in assists with 15 during her freshman campaign.
The Providence Friars took top honors in the coach's poll, with five first place votes. BC will face the Friars four times this season. The Eagles will take to the ice against their first opponent the Polar Bears Hockey Club on Sunday, October 12. The puck will drop at 1 p.m. in Conte Forum.
